Introduction to Biomedical Optics
Describes both diagnostic and therapeutic optical methods in medicine. This work covers the history of optics theory and the basic science behind light-tissue interactions. It looks at light-tissue interactions and their applications in different medical areas, such as wound healing and tissue welding.
